The latest version of BisQue integrates CellProfiler ( ), a software for the quantitative analysis of biological images, developed at the Broad Institute. CellProfiler is designed for modular, flexible, high-throughput analysis of images, measuring size, shape, intensity, and texture of every cell (or other object) in one or more images.
